How much do software test anal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for software test analyst in the United States is $42.27,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34.13 and $51.92 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Software Test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Software Test Analyst, you need a solid understanding of software development lifecycles, test case design, and defect tracking,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with test management tools like JIRA, Selenium, or TestRail, and certifications such as ISTQB, are highly valuable.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and strong communication skills set outstanding candidates apart. These abilities are crucial for ensuring software quality, identifying issues early, and facilitating effective collaboration between development and QA teams.

What are the primary methods a Software Test Analyst uses to collaborate with developers and other stakeholders during the testing process?

Software Test Analysts typically work closely with developers, project managers, and business analysts through regular meetings, bug triage sessions, and sprint reviews. They use tools like Jira, TestRail, or Azure DevOps to document defects, track test cases, and ensure clear communication. Active participation in Agile ceremonies, such as daily stand-ups and sprint planning, helps them align testing priorities with development goals. This collaboration ensures issues are identified and resolved quickly, leading to higher quality software and smoother releases.

What is the difference between Software Test Analyst vs Software Tester?

AspectSoftware Test AnalystSoftware Tester
CertificationsISTQB Foundation, ISTQB AdvancedISTQB Foundation, ISTQB Certified Tester
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with QA teams, developers, and business analysts in structured testing processesPerforms manual or automated testing, often independently or in small teams
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across IT, finance, healthcare, and software development companiesCommonly found in software development firms, IT departments, and testing service providers

The Software Test Analyst typically has a broader role involving test planning, analysis, and documentation, working closely with stakeholders. In contrast, the Software Tester mainly focuses on executing test cases and reporting defects. Both roles require similar certifications and are integral to quality assurance in software development.

What Does a Software Test Analyst Do?

Software test analysts, also known as software testers or test engineers, are responsible for testing, analyzing, and evaluating new software operations or applications. They work on every stage of development from start to finish, offering advice and examining the programs at each phase of the building process. Software test analysts run trials for functionality, performance, and user experience from the early stages to review areas that need improvement.

What does a Software Test Analyst do?

A Software Test Analyst is responsible for evaluating software applications to ensure they meet specified requirements and function as intended. They design test cases, execute tests, and document defects or issues found during the testing process. Software Test Analysts work closely with developers and other team members to understand system functionality, report bugs, and verify fixes. Their main goal is to ensure the quality, reliability, and performance of software before it is released to users.
